Page MenuHomePhabricator

Implement bulk JSI call te retrieve all SQLite data
ClosedPublic

Authored by marcin on Nov 30 2022, 11:29 AM.
Tags
None
Referenced Files
F3500347: D5774.id19097.diff
Fri, Dec 20, 1:17 AM
F3500255: D5774.id19028.diff
Fri, Dec 20, 1:07 AM
F3497807: D5774.diff
Thu, Dec 19, 7:59 PM
Unknown Object (File)
Sat, Dec 14, 12:54 AM
Unknown Object (File)
Mon, Dec 9, 11:45 AM
Unknown Object (File)
Mon, Dec 9, 7:05 AM
Unknown Object (File)
Fri, Nov 22, 6:45 AM
Unknown Object (File)
Fri, Nov 22, 6:45 AM
Subscribers

Details

Summary

This differential implements one JSI call to retrieve SQLite data.

Test Plan

Use this new call instead of separate calls for messages, threads and drafts in SQLiteDataHandler. Ensure in flipper SET_CLIENT_DB_STORE action payload is correct.

Diff Detail

Repository
rCOMM Comm
Branch
marcin/eng-2137
Lint
No Lint Coverage
Unit
No Test Coverage

Event Timeline

not familiar enough with c++ best practices to provide valuable feedback

I'll edit the herald rules to avoid these files

This revision is now accepted and ready to land.Dec 1 2022, 6:19 AM